Tribune News Service

Ludhiana, July 12

In view of the ongoing construction of elevated road (Samrala Chowk to Ferozepur Road Octroi), Mayor Balkar Singh Sandhu has assured the residents that soon, there would be no traffic congestion on Ferozepur Road and traffic would move smoothly.

The Mayor, Balkar Singh Sandhu today inspected the construction site. He was accompanied by councillor from Ward No. 67 Mamta Ashu and senior officials.

The Mayor directed the contractor concerned to formulate a plan within two days, so the slip road (starting from near Nanaksar Gurdwara to Bharat Nagar Chowk) is put to optimum use for the benefit of commuters. He also directed the contractor to remove bushes on some areas along Ferozepur Road where the slip road was yet to be constructed.

During a meeting held near Gurdwara Nanaksar, Mamta Ashu stated that the ongoing construction of elevated road had caused a lot of inconvenience to commuters, as the width of Ferozepur Road has narrowed down in some patches.

The contractor has been asked to submit a detailed plan clearly mentioning the measures to be taken for ensuring a smooth flow of traffic on portions where construction activity is taking place.

Mamta Ashu said they would not allow the contractor to start construction activity in any place until he formulated an alternative plan for traffic and got it approved by the authorities.

The police have been asked to make sure there is no encroachment on the road.
